The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association is committed to supporting the Faculty of Law, its alumni, and its current students. The association supports these groups in many ways.

Faculty

  • The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association helps defray the costs associated with publishing the Faculty of Law’s alumni magazine, Without Prejudice. By contributing approximately half of the bi-annual magazine’s publication costs, the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association enables the faculty to allocate additional funds from its operating budget to faculty enhancements and special projects.

  • In a continuous effort to raise the profile of the faculty, the association participates in public relations efforts, and coordinates a variety of events held at the faculty.

Alumni

  • The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association is committed to helping alumni maintain a connection to the faculty by organizing various alumni gatherings. These events include the annual spring reception held in Edmonton, as well as individual receptions hosted by Alumni and Friends branches across Canada.

  • The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association's Spring Reception has been held at the Edmonton Fairmont Hotel Macdonald for the last ten years. Aside from being the major fund-raiser for the association, the spring reception has grown to become a major social event within the Edmonton area legal community, attracting both alumni and non-alumni. The 2010 Spring Reception, held on June 16, was a great success thanks to increased support from our sponsors and strong attendance.

  • As one of its missions is to help alumni connect with each other, the association works to develop entertaining social programs that are attractive to alumni of all ages.

  • Class reunions are a great opportunity for alumni to renew old acquaintances, and the association is pleased to support these special events.

  • The association is very proud of its working relationship with the Canadian Bar Association Alberta, resulting in both organizations co-hosting an annual "Meet the Bench" reception, bringing articling students together with members of the judiciary.

Students

  • The association is very proud to fund the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association Bursary, which generates approximately $2000 in funds annually in the form of 2 - $1000 bursaries. In addition, to mark the association's 10th anniversary, 10 bursaries of $1000 each were awarded. The bursaries are awarded to students in good standing based on financial need.

  • Each first-year student receives a welcome gift from the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association.

  • The association coordinates a Welcome Call Program, giving first year students the opportunity to receive a personal phone call from an alumnus. By starting the networking process, this phone call is a great benefit to students as they can ask questions about the law school experience, career opportunities and other information.

  • The Faculty of Law’s socially conscious student body undertakes many charitable initiatives, including the famed Law Show. All proceeds from this student-led variety show production are donated to an Edmonton-based charity. The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association is pleased to support this annual event.

  • To celebrate their graduation from the Faculty of Law, third-year students receive a composite class graduation photo courtesy of the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association. These special student gifts serve as both a special keepsake of their time at the faculty, as well as an official welcome to the Alumni & Friends of the Faculty of Law Association.
